#include using namespace std; using ll = long long; #define rep(i,n) for (int i=0;i<(int)(n);i++) ll d2(ll x){ double y=x; y=y*y; if(y>4e18) return 4e18; else return x*x; } int main(){ ll n,x,y; cin>>n>>x>>y; vector r(n); ll rs=0; rep(i,n){ cin>>r.at(i); rs+=r.at(i)*2; } sort(r.begin(),r.end()); rs-=r.at(0); if(n==1){ if(x*x+y*y==r.at(0)*r.at(0)) cout<<"Yes"<